The Winston-Salem Cycling Classic is a women's one-day road bicycle race held in the United States. Between 2017 and 2019, it was rated by the UCI as a 1.1 race. [3]

Past winners

Road race

YearCountryRiderTeam
2013Flag of the United States.svg  United States Alison Powers NOW and Novartis for MS
2014 Flag of the United States.svg  United States Shelley Olds Alé–Cipollini
2015 Flag of Belarus.svg  Belarus Alena Amialiusik Velocio–SRAM
2016 Flag of Italy.svg  Italy Rossella Ratto Cylance Pro Cycling
2017 Flag of the United States.svg  United States Lauren Stephens Tibco–Silicon Valley Bank
2018 Flag of the United States.svg  United States Lily Williams Hagens Berman–Supermint
2019 Flag of the United States.svg  United States Leigh Ann Ganzar Hagens Berman–Supermint
2020No race due to the COVID-19 pandemic in North Carolina
2021No race
